The website discusses the moon's recession from Earth at 3.8 centimeters per year, its formation 4.5 billion years ago, and the initial distance between the moon and Earth. It also mentions the lengthening of Earth's days due to tidal friction and the Lunar Laser Ranging Experiment's role in measuring these changes.

The claims regarding the Moon's recession from Earth, its formation age, and the initial distance from Earth are well-supported by scientific evidence. The Lunar Laser Ranging Experiment provides precise measurements confirming the recession rate. The lengthening of Earth's days due to tidal friction is also supported, though with slight discrepancies in the exact rate. Overall, the claims are factual and supported by authoritative sources.

Days lengthen on Earth by about 1.7 milliseconds per century due to tidal friction.
The evidence suggests that Earth's rotation slows due to tidal friction, lengthening days. However, the exact rate varies slightly among sources, with some stating 1.8 milliseconds per century. This discrepancy slightly lowers the confidence.
